Best Lakewood Public Elementary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public elementary schools serving 1,207 students in the neighborhood of Lakewood, Norfolk, VA.
The top-ranked public elementary schools in Lakewood are Academy For Discovery At Lakewood and Willard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
The neighborhood of Lakewood, Norfolk, VA public elementary schools have an average math proficiency score of 40% (versus the Virginia public elementary school average of 67%), and reading proficiency score of 73% (versus the 67%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 62%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Virginia public elementary school average of 56% (majority Black and Hispanic).
